Specifications
- Product Status: Active
- Output Configuration: Positive
- Output Type: Fixed
- Number of Regulators: 1
- Voltage - Input (Max): 5.5V
- Voltage - Output (Min/Fixed): 1.8V
- Voltage - Output (Max): -
- Voltage Dropout (Max): 0.38V @ 100mA
- Current - Output: 100mA
- Current - Quiescent (Iq): 0.5 µA
- Current - Supply (Max): -
- PSRR: -
- Control Features: Enable
- Protection Features: Over Current
- Operating Temperature: -40°C ~ 85°C (TA)
- Mounting Type: Surface Mount
- Package / Case: 4-XFBGA, WLCSP
- Supplier Device Package: WLCSP-4-P8
